Floodwaters in Jakarta Confirmed to Recede Completely

Jakarta Regional Disaster Handling Agency (BPBD) recorded all inundated areas in Jakarta have receded fully at 2 PM, Wednesday (7/9).

Jakarta BPBD Head, Isnawa Adji thanked the collaboration of BPBD, Water Resources Agency, Fire Handling and Rescue Agency, Bina Marga Agency, Environmental Agency, Satpol PP and Urban Village PPSU by deploying personnel and equipment to handle the inundation.

"Community from RT/RW, FKDM, and public figure are also involved," he added.

Jakarta BPBD appeals the residents to remain alert with another inundation potential.

"Please contact our free 24-hour service at 112 for an emergency situation," he continued.

Previously, heavy rain that poured in Jakarta and its surrounding areas on Saturday (7/5) until Monday (7/7) made the road and residential were inundated.
